Grandpa Frank stretched his gray paws in the morning sun. His cabin sat deep in the autumn woods. "Time to explore!" he said, grabbing his walking stick.

Frank loved to run through forests and climb tall hills. He collected pine cones and pretty rocks. But his cabin felt too quiet when he returned each evening.

"Surprise!" Two young wolves jumped from behind the porch. "We're here for the whole week, Grandpa!" Frank's grandcubs, Luna and Max, had come to visit.

"Can we explore with you?" asked Luna. "We want to see everything!" added Max. Frank's tail wagged fast. This week would be different!

Frank grabbed three backpacks from his shed. "First, we need supplies," he said. The cubs helped pack water, snacks, and a mysterious seed packet Frank had saved.

They marched into the forest together. Frank showed them deer tracks in the mud. "Look close," he said. "Every mark tells a story."

Luna discovered a hollow log full of acorns. Max found a feather stuck in tree bark. "You're natural explorers!" Frank said proudly.

By the creek, Frank tried to leap across like old times. His paws slipped on wet stones. Splash! He landed in shallow water, laughing.

"Are you hurt?" the cubs asked, worried. Frank shook water from his fur. "Just wet! Sometimes we need to slow down," he admitted.

They built a bridge from fallen branches instead. Working together took longer but felt better. The cubs cheered when they crossed safely.

At the meadow's edge, Max started to wheeze. "My chest feels tight," he said. Frank recognized the signs - Max needed rest and his breathing medicine.

Frank made a cozy spot under an oak tree. He gave Max water and helped him breathe slowly. "Adventures can wait," Frank said gently.

While Max rested, Frank told stories about this very tree. "Your grandmother and I planted it forty years ago," he said. The cubs listened with wide eyes.

"Can we plant our own memory tree?" Luna asked. Frank remembered the seed packet! "That's exactly what these maple seeds are for," he smiled.

Together they dug a hole near the cabin. Each wolf dropped in a seed. "This tree will grow with your visits," Frank explained.

They patted soil around the seeds and watered them carefully. "When you're grandparents, this tree will be taller than the cabin!" Frank said.

That evening, they sat on the porch watching fireflies. Frank didn't feel restless at all. The cabin buzzed with laughter and stories.

"Tomorrow can we plant more trees?" Max asked. "And make a sign?" added Luna. Frank nodded, his heart full. Some adventures grew slowly.

The best expeditions weren't always the farthest. Sometimes they took root right where love lived. Frank hugged his grandcubs close beneath the stars.
